- While the list of restricted items differs between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like tools, metal cutlery, aerosol cans and flares. Sports equipment like golf clubs, and items that could injure passengers, such as guns and swords, are also banned from the cabin.
- Go for comfort over style. Prepare for temperature changes by layering up, and pick flat, closed-toe footwear like slip-ons.
- You've probably he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by long periods of inactivity. To lessen your risk on board, drink lots of water, consider wearing compression tights or socks and do gentle foot and leg exercises in your seat.
How to get through airport security fast when flying to Salto?
- Airport security personnel first need to check that you have a valid passport and matching boarding pass before anything else.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
- The X-ray machine is up next. Empty your pockets and remove anything that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
-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also have to go through the machine for inspection. Don't worry though, you'll be back online before you know it.
- Don't for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
- There's a good chance you'll be required to remove your shoes for scanning,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a good idea.
- Airlines won't allow any sharp items or pocket knives in your hand lu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ked luggage.
